Human performance is a key contributor to nuclear power plant safety. Recognizing this, the Canadian Nuclear Safety Commission (CNSC) requires nuclear power plants to implement and maintain human performance programs.

CONT

In addition to this general day-to-day feedback, CNSC staff noted that it monitors several aspects of the operations where a decline in safety culture or human performance would become evident; such as in training, maintenance backlogs, the number and type of events and their root causes, hiring and contracting practices, and document quality.

Human performance focuses on the examination and mechanisms in human spatial orientation, including the study of internal and mental cues from physical stimuli that allow humans to orient themselves in gravity or non-gravity situations. Research includes: human eye movement versus robotic vision systems; the use of 'heads up' helmets-mounted displays; human perception in motion and human visual disorders.
